Discover the vibrant soul of Argentina with Kaleu Malbec Bonarda, a wine that beautifully captures the essence of the Mendoza region. Produced by the renowned Bodega Los Haroldos, a family-owned winery with over 70 years of viticultural heritage, this blend is a masterclass in balance and accessibility. The name 'Kaleu' itself holds deep cultural significance, rooted in the language of the indigenous Mapuche people of Mendoza, where it represents a guardian bird—a fitting symbol for a wine that protects and celebrates the history and spirit of its land.

This wine is a harmonious marriage of two of Argentina's most iconic red varieties. The Malbec provides a bold, structured backbone with its characteristic notes of dark plums and blackcurrants, while the Bonarda adds a layer of juiciness, vibrant acidity, and a soft, supple texture that makes the wine incredibly drinkable. Because it is crafted as an unoaked, fruit-forward red, it retains a pure, lively expression of the grapes, making it an excellent companion for everyday enjoyment rather than a wine that demands decades of cellaring.

On the palate, you will experience a smooth, round mouthfeel that is neither overly aggressive nor too light. It offers a refreshing lift of acidity that balances its rich fruit profile, leading to a clean and pleasant finish. It is the perfect 'go-to' wine for a variety of occasions—whether you are hosting a casual dinner with friends or simply winding down after a long day.

When it comes to food pairing, Kaleu Malbec Bonarda is exceptionally versatile. Its fruit-forward character and soft tannins make it an ideal match for traditional Argentine favorites like a hearty churrasco (barbecue), roasted red meats, or savory sausages. If you prefer something lighter, it pairs beautifully with pasta served in a rich meat or tomato-based sauce, and it is also delightful when served alongside a spread of mild cheeses and grilled vegetables.
